HERE YOU CAN KNOW THE TERMS AND CONDITIONS THAT WE HAVE IN SPELT

IT IS NECESSARY TO ACCEPT THEM TO CONTINUE WITH THE REGISTRATION TO YOUR COURSE

A.-Language Courses are a service operated by SPELT Idiomas S,C. (hereinafter SPELT) that entitles the client to receive instruction for learning the chosen language, at the frequency and time set at the beginning of the course. In GROUP classes, SPELT chooses its schedule and frequency of the course. These Terms and Conditions are valid for courses taught online. SPELT has six (6) levels for teaching any language, each with a duration of 90 hours of instruction. At the end of these 6 levels, the client can choose to take Conversation levels. Class hours cannot be transferred to another person or group. SPELT provides the service of locating the client in any of the six levels, this through the application of a location test, online, which has no cost. In GROUP classes, the schedule and frequency of the course cannot be changed during the duration of the course, unless otherwise agreed with SPELT. The necessary material for the online course will be provided by SPELT at the beginning of the course. The 90-hour levels are divided into 30-hour modules for the convenience of the client in relation to payment. The client agrees to take the full level of 90 class hours.

 

B.- In GROUP classes, cancellations are allowed where the group agrees and decides to move or cancel the class for any reason. The GROUP can only have 2 hours (120 minutes) of class per month that appear as CANCELED IN TIME. From the third hour of class canceled by the group WITH TIME (more than 24 hours), you will not have the right to replace it and it will be taken as a class already taught, that is, it will be billed as if it had been canceled WITHOUT TIME. The 120 minutes of CANCELLATIONS WITH TIME, can be recovered within the following 30 days after the date on which the cancellation occurs, with the exception of absences that occur in the last month of the course. In this case, the last day to recover any cancellation will have to be BEFORE the end date of the level. If they could not be recovered, the group will understand that said benefit was lost. In GROUP courses, students understand that if the student is absent, there are no individual replacements.

 

C.- SPELT has no obligation to offer its services to any other person or group not specified in this contract. D. The minimum number of participants for GROUP classes is 6 students. If this number is not met, the start date is rescheduled within the following two weeks from the original date of the course. In case of not completing the necessary quorum for the class, your refund is scheduled in the following 5-7 days after the cancellation notice.

 

E.- The client agrees to pay all the fees related to his course and material in the stipulated periods. Failing to take the class, or withdrawing from the course, does not exempt the client from paying the remaining fees. If the student wants to drop the course, they have to cover the missing payments to finish the 90 hour level. Courses with recurring payments by PayPal are not cancelable. In the event that the payment is rejected by the client's bank, the client must cover said fee by bank transfer   or change the account in which the charges will be made. The client will receive a payment reminder 8 days before, so that they keep the necessary funds in the account and be able to debit the payment. The levels are 90 hours long, and the packages are designed precisely for the student to finish the entire level, in order to advance to the next one. 

F.- The courses or levels do not extend the date. In the case of GROUP COURSES, there is no class stand-by. In some cases or special dates, such as Christmas week or Easter, the GROUP can agree to recover those hours from before, and be able to take a break. 

 

G.- If the student is enrolled in a course with a different duration, such as 30-hour courses, 20-hour seminars, exam preparation, 40-hour modules, etc., the same Terms apply in relation to payment, mentioned in subsection former. By enrolling and signing this document, you agree that you will cover all fees for the contracted course. If the course or seminar consists of a single payment at the beginning, it is covered before starting.

 

H- Online courses are taught through the Zoom Business platform. It is the responsibility of the client or student to have the application installed before starting the course. A league is automatically sent where you can take your classes. The schedules of the courses taught at SPELT are based on the time zone of Mexico City, unless otherwise specified. Students are responsible for verifying said information in case they live in another city or country, as well as being aware of possible time changes in summer/autumn according to the calendar set by the Government itself. The student has a stable internet connection to take the course, and if he does not have it, he will look for a way to connect, separating SPELT from any problem with his connection. 

 

I.- At the end of each level, that is, upon completing 90 class hours, SPELT will award a diploma to students who have met the course objectives and who have more than 85% attendance. Students agree to electronically sign their attendance at the end of each class to verify both their attendance and that of the teacher.

 

J.- To control the quality of the service, SPELT applies a satisfaction survey to evaluate the teacher's performance, this survey is carried out when the course has progress of more than  50%, and is done electronically.
